Anthropologists study human behavior and thought in both the past and the present with the goal of improving our world. We holistically draw on sociocultural, archaeological, and biological approaches to engage with humanity’s current challenges: the outcomes of the humanity-environment relationship; human rights abuses and the need for social justice; and the complexities of human heritage and identities. Whether through ethnographic fieldwork, archaeological excavation, biological lab work, or visual and material cultural analysis, our students and faculty collaborate closely to learn and improve our knowledge of human variation. This is an invaluable resource for our students as they prepare for a more complex future.
The Anthropology Major consists of 24 required course credits plus 12 elective credits that allow students to augment their education with a dual major or minor in another field applicable to their goals and needs.

Type of Scholarship | Scholarship Information | Amount/ Range |
Empire Scholarship Green Scholarship Gold Scholarship Honors/Prometheus Award International Transfer Award |
Empire Scholarship Criteria: All admitted first-year international students who pay out-of-state tuition. Green Scholarship Criteria: All admitted first-year international students; can be combined with the Empire Scholarship. Gold Scholarship Criteria: High-achieving first-year international applicants; can be combined with the Empire Scholarship. Honors/Prometheus Award Criteria: Students accepted into the Honors College; separate application required; Fall start only; stackable with Empire Scholarship. International Transfer Award Criteria: Transfer students with a GPA of 3.0 or higher and a minimum of 24 completed college credits. Note: No campus residency requirement. LINK: https://www.brockport.edu/scholarships-aid/international-scholarships/ |
Empire Scholarship Amount: $5,000 per year, renewable for 4 years. Green Scholarship Amount: $2,500 per year, renewable for 4 years. Gold Scholarship Amount: $4,500 per year, renewable for 4 years. Honors/Prometheus Award Amount: $6,000 per year, renewable for 4 years, plus campus parking pass. International Transfer Award Amount: $3,000 per year, renewable for up to 2 years with a 3.0 institutional GPA. |
